Job Title: Erosion Management Specialist Intern

Job Type: Unpaid Internship

Location: Eidson, TN

Duration: 6 months

 

Job Description:

We are seeking an Erosion Management Specialist Intern to assist with the management of erosion control and mitigation efforts. The Erosion Management Specialist Intern will work alongside our experienced team to implement best practices and strategies for mitigating erosion, protecting water quality, and preserving natural resources.


Responsibilities:

  • Assist with erosion control measures, including the installation of sediment control devices and stabilization techniques.
  • Conduct site inspections to assess erosion risk and identify areas in need of erosion control measures.
  • Assist with the development of erosion control plans and cost estimates.
  • Provide technical support to construction crews and contractors to ensure proper implementation of erosion control measures.
  • Assist with the monitoring and maintenance of erosion control measures to ensure their effectiveness over time.
  • Assist with the documentation and reporting of erosion control efforts to regulatory agencies and stakeholders.
  • Participate in team meetings and training sessions to stay current with best practices and new developments in erosion management.

Qualifications:

  • Currently enrolled in a degree program related to environmental science, natural resources management, or a related field.
  • Strong interest in erosion management and environmental conservation.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ively as part of a team and independently.
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ills.
  • Familiarity with GIS and CAD software is a plus.

This is an unpaid internship, and the Erosion Management Specialist Intern will have the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in erosion control and mitigation efforts. The successful candidate will work closely with our team to learn and develop new skills in the field of environmental management.
